Best time to go to Oxford

The best time to visit Oxford can depend on the weather and when visitor numbers rise and fall. The hottest average temperature in Oxford falls in July, when visitor numbers are slightly high and weather is mostly cloudy with light rain. The coolest average temperature in Oxford falls in January, visitor numbers are average and weather is mostly cloudy with light rain.

calendarCalendar MonthtemperatureTemperaturerainPrecipitationmostlyCloudinessoccupationOccupancypricePricing
January38.8°F (3.8°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ly Low
February40.1°F (4.5°C)No Rain (Dry)Mostly CloudyAverageAverage
March43.0°F (6.1°C)No Rain (Dry)Mostly CloudyAverageAverage
April46.9°F (8.3°C)No Rain (Dry)Mostly CloudySlightly HighAverage
May52.5°F (11.4°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
June58.3°F (14.6°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ly High
July62.2°F (16.8°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ly HighSlightly High
August61.5°F (16.4°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
September57.6°F (14.2°C)No Rain (Dry)Mostly SunnySlightly HighSlightly High
October52.0°F (11.1°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ly LowSlightly Low
November45.1°F (7.3°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ly LowSlightly Low
December41.2°F (5.1°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ly LowAverage

The nearest major airports for your trip to Oxford

For your visit to Oxford, you have several major airports to consider. London Heathrow (LHR) is approximately 64.4km away, with excellent hotels like the 5-star Sofitel London Heathrow, 3.2km from the airport. Birmingham Airport (BHX) is about 53.2km away, featuring the luxurious Hampton Manor, just 3.2km from the airport. Alternatively, London Luton (LTN) is located 62.8km from Oxford, with the upscale Luton Hoo Hotel, Golf And Spa only 3.2km away. What's the seasonal weather in Oxford?

The hottest months are usually July and August, with an average temperature of 16°C, while the coldest months are January and February, with an average of 5°C. Average annual precipitation for Oxford is 715 mm.
